Hi guys, been staring at my stock FGX for the past 2 days. Trying to figure out how to corner faster.

The front axle slop. - I think I found a permanent cure. The superglue axle tip does not last long. What I did was get the inner ring of an old front bearing, then sandwich that between the two front axle bearings inside the steering knuckle. No more slop. And can tighten wheel nut without fear of crushing the bearings.

Stiffen the rear. - Without changing kit springs, I found that inserting a spacer on the lower ball (that connects the lower part of the shock to the cantilever) stiffens the rear noticeably without need to change to a stiffer spring.

Now if I can just chop off another 100 grams...

Originally Posted by bertrandsv87
I think the Tp4300 65c packs (250grams) are a good choice for those 10minute Mains....
It's a 21.5t motor, pretty much any battery can get it through a 10mins main.
The only reason to use a long pack is that, there are some race I know in People's Republic of China, that has 30mins A main race. Shorty pack may reach low voltage and slow down in the last few minutes.

*shorty packs are 190-200g. around 100g lighter than long pack.
